FREEPORT (WIFR) -- FHN and Sodexo will offer a spring session of Create Your Weight for Kids, a kids’ version of the popular, personalized weight reduction and management program developed and taught by registered dietitians.
The 10-week program, designed to be attended by one adult with each child, begins April 4, with classes each Thursday from 5 to 5:45 p.m. at FHN Memorial Hospital, 1045 W. Stephenson Street in Freeport. Topics to be covered include:
• Portions and servings
• Making good choices when dining out
• Snacking
• Importance of physical activity
• Family involvement in healthy behaviors
• Building self-esteem and confidence
• Knowing the difference between eating when you’re hungry vs. other reasons
The cost of the program, including all class sessions for each adult-and-child pair and healthy snacks, is $125. Kids in the class earn “Nutribucks” that can be redeemed for prizes, and those who complete the class will also receive a free trial membership from the YMCA of Northwest Illinois at Highland Community College in Freeport.
